Decoding EOG Resources: A Public Company Unveiled
Alright, folks, the big question: Is EOG Resources a public company? The answer, in short, is a resounding YES! EOG Resources operates as a publicly traded entity. This means that shares of the company are available for purchase and sale on major stock exchanges. The company's stock ticker symbol is EOG, and you can find it listed on the New York Stock Exchange (NYSE). Being a public company comes with a bunch of implications, including increased transparency, regulatory oversight, and the ability to raise capital through the issuance of stock. EOG Resources has a significant market capitalization, indicating its substantial size and influence within the energy sector. As a public company, EOG Resources is obligated to regularly disclose financial information, performance metrics, and strategic initiatives to its shareholders and the public. These disclosures help investors make informed decisions about whether to buy, sell, or hold the company's stock. Moreover, being publicly traded often exposes a company to greater scrutiny from analysts, investors, and the media, which can influence its reputation and stock performance. Unveiling EOG Resources' Business Operations
Let's switch gears and explore the core of EOG Resources' business operations. This company is primarily engaged in the exploration, development, and production of crude oil and natural gas. Their business strategy focuses on acquiring and developing high-quality oil and gas properties, particularly in the United States. EOG Resources employs advanced drilling techniques and technologies to extract these resources efficiently. This helps them stay competitive in the market. The company also emphasizes cost control and operational efficiency to maximize profitability. A major part of their work is focused on unconventional oil and gas resources, such as shale formations. This involves using hydraulic fracturing (fracking) to extract oil and gas from these formations. They have a significant presence in major shale plays across the country, including the Permian Basin, Eagle Ford, and Bakken. These areas are rich in oil and gas reserves, and EOG Resources has strategically positioned itself to capitalize on these opportunities. EOG Resources' Key Areas of Operation
EOG Resources' operations are strategically focused across several key areas, contributing to its overall success in the energy sector. A major focus is on the Permian Basin, located in West Texas and New Mexico. This region is a hotbed for oil and gas activity, and EOG Resources has a significant presence there, capitalizing on its vast reserves and strong production potential. The Eagle Ford Shale in South Texas is another important area of operation. This region is known for its high-quality oil and gas resources, and EOG Resources continues to invest in and develop its assets there. The company's operations also extend to the Bakken Shale, which spans North Dakota and Montana. The Bakken is another key region where EOG Resources is actively engaged in the exploration and production of oil and gas. They also have a presence in other strategic areas, including the Powder River Basin and various other regions with significant potential. Key Financial Metrics to Watch for EOG Resources
When evaluating EOG Resources, several key financial metrics should be carefully watched. Revenue is a primary indicator of the company's top-line performance. It is directly impacted by the price and volume of oil, natural gas, and NGLs. Earnings per share (EPS) is crucial as it reflects the company's profitability on a per-share basis. Net income, the bottom line of the income statement, measures the company's overall profitability after all expenses. Cash flow from operations highlights the company's ability to generate cash from its core business activities. This metric is a strong indicator of financial health and operational efficiency. The company's debt levels and debt-to-equity ratio provide insights into its financial risk. A manageable level of debt indicates financial stability, while a high debt burden may raise concerns. Capital expenditures (CAPEX), which include investments in property, plant, and equipment, are vital. They show the company's commitment to maintaining and expanding its production capacity. Free cash flow (FCF), which measures the cash flow available to the company after CAPEX, is an important metric. A positive FCF can be used for debt reduction, dividends, or share repurchases. Investors also keep an eye on the company's operating margins, which measure profitability relative to revenue. These margins reflect the company's ability to manage its costs and maximize its profitability. The return on equity (ROE) and return on assets (ROA) are important profitability ratios that demonstrate how efficiently the company is using shareholder equity and assets.
